Refinancing your home loan means you must interchange your present loan with a new one. This is extremely communal even if the existing loan ratios are rising or falling. You are not really limited to working with your current creditor.

This is the current process:
– You’ve got a present loan
– You applied for a new loan
– The latest loan pays off the existing loan
– You’re now left with the new loan

Mortgage refinancing is undoubtedly time intensive and it’s also expensive most of the time.

Here’s why you still want to push ahead:
Pay Off The Loan – This will provide you with some extra time to pay off your loan that is due by refinancing with a new one.

Consolidate debts – It’s going to undoubtedly make sense to put all your loans to a single one, particularly if you are going to obtain a lower rate. It’s going to actually be easier to track your payments and mortgages.

It can Improve Cash Flow– It will make cash flow management easier and it is going to leave more money in your budget for other monthly expenses.

Saves money– this is a very common place reason for interest costs. This will require that you refinance into a credit with lower interest rate than your current ratio. This savings might be very significant as well when we discuss long – term loans.

Fixed Factors:
Collateral– If you’re using collateral for the loan, that security will possibly still be needed for the new loan.

Payments– You’ve got a brand new loan and the payments are primarily focused on that loan balance, term and interest rate. Generally, your monthly payment can change once you refinance.

Debts– You still have a debt and it is the same amount as before, unless you’ll enhance your debt or take a cash out.

There are some disadvantages too:
Transaction Costs– With mortgage like home loans, you’ll pay settlement costs which could equal to thousands of dollars.

Lost Benefits– some loans have important features which will vanish entirely if you refinance.

Additional Interest Costs– when you broaden out a loan over a longer period of time, you pay more interest.

You should always remember that refinancing will not always be a good choice.

Federal Housing Administration (FHA) Loan– Home Buyers with this sort of loans pay for mortgage insurance, which safeguards the lender from a loss if the borrower evades the loan.

Generally, it guarantees mortgages and it doesn’t lend money. The FHA will enable the home buyers to invest 56 or 57 percent of their income on monthly debt responsibilities. In contrast, conventional mortgage guidelines tend to cap *debt-to-income ratios at around 43 percent. FHA loan borrowers might actually qualify if they have a credit rating of 580 or below.

Here are the beneficiaries:
– Borrowers with low acclaim scores.
– Individuals whose house payments might be a big chunk of your take-home pay.
– Housebuyers with small down payments and refinancers with little equity.

*Debt-to-income ratio:
This is actually the percentage of monthly income allocated to debt payments like mortgages, student loans, auto loans, minimal credit card payments and child support.

VA loan or Veterans Affairs Mortgage was designed to offer long-term financing to all of the qualified American veterans including their surviving partners assuming they didn’t remarry. This is really done to offer home financing to the suitable veterans in the places where private financing is not actually available and to help them buy properties without down payment. The Veteran Loan program is made for veterans who satisfy the minimal length of time of completed service.

Listed below are some of the requirements of the program:
– Duty status
– Character of service
– The length of service

VA loans do not typically have a minimum credit rating for prequalification. Nevertheless, most lenders would actually require a credit rating of 620. Some of the beneficiaries of this loan are National Guard members, spouses of military members and active duty military and veterans.

USDA loan (UNITED STATES DEPARTMENT OF AGRICULTURE) is a kind of loan which will lessen the cost for homeowners in rural and suburban areas.

Qualifiers:
– For the geographic areas, the property need to be situated in a USDA-qualified area. Home Buyers can search USDA’s maps to browse certain areas for a particular address.
– Home Buyers must satisfy the income and credit standards

Lending recommendations were actually made by the USDA program and this is actually the main reason why it is known as the USDA Rural Development (RD) Loan.

Plenty of assets out of the town are qualified for USDA financing which is definitely worth your time and effort even if you think that your area is too developed to be regarded as rural. You’ll find USDA eligibility maps that are based on population data from census in the year 2000. This is absolutely a great opportunity to finance suburban homes before the maps are updated.

Conventional loan is the type of loan which is not a part of a specific program like:
FHA (Federal Housing Administration), VA (Veterans Affairs) and USDA (United States Department of Agriculture). It actually has fixed terms and rates. The mortgages that are not assured by government agencies are frequently known as conventional home loans and they include:

Conforming– A conforming mortgage will always follow recommendations.

Non-Conforming: These mortgages include both ‘jumbo loans’ which exceed the loan limits imposed by government-backed agencies.

Portfolio loans Sub-prime loans– These are the loans marketed to home-buyers with a low credit score. They normally come with high interests and fees. The government has established unique rules to cover the sale of such items that are considered conventional loans.

Qualifiers for a Conventional Loan:
– Prove a stable income
– Have a good credit rating
– Make a sizeable down payment
